| Aspect | Director Carelonrx | Pharmacist |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Advanced degree (e.g., PharmD), management experience | Pharmacy degree (PharmD or BS Pharm), licensure |
| Work Environment | Healthcare management, corporate settings | Retail, hospital, or clinical pharmacy |
| Industry Usage | Healthcare companies, pharmacy benefit managers | Pharmacies, hospitals, clinics |
The main difference is that a Director Carelonrx focuses on overseeing pharmacy benefit management and healthcare programs at an organizational level, requiring management skills and strategic planning. In contrast, a Pharmacist is directly involved in dispensing medications and patient care. Both roles require healthcare knowledge, but their responsibilities and work environments differ significantly.
